Associate / Staff Python Developer
SciTec, a wholly owned subsidiary of Firefly Aerospace, is a dynamic non-traditional defense contractor that delivers advanced technologies in support of U.S. National Security and Defense. For the past forty-five plus years, we have supported Department of Defense customers by developing innovative remote sensing algorithms, tools, and techniques to deliver world-class data exploitation capabilities supporting missile defense; intelligence, surveillance, & reconnaissance; space domain awareness; and aircraft survivability missions.
Important Notice: SciTec exclusively works on U.S. government contracts that require U.S. citizenship for all employees. SciTec cannot sponsor or assume sponsorship of employee work visas of any type. Further, U.S. citizenship is a requirement to obtain and keep a security clearance. Applicants that do not meet these requirements will not be considered.
SciTec has an immediate on-site opportunity in Boulder, Colorado for a talented Python Software Developer to support our programs delivering Next-Generation Missile Warning software. You will work within a fast-paced team delivering end-to-end software processing of Overhead Persistent InfraRed (OPIR) sensor data for Missile Warning, Missile Defense, Battlespace Awareness, and Technical Intelligence. You will develop modern Python applications for data processing, deployed to our customer and industry partner sites. Our ideal candidate is a well-rounded, experienced software engineer who works well as a part of a team, prioritizes the quality of their product, and seizes opportunities to be creative, learn, and grow as a developer.
Responsibilities
- Develop Python applications in unclassified and classified environments.
- Contribute to the improvement of various Python tools surrounding our machine learning/modeling/simulation efforts.
- Execute tasks that require familiarity with development tools, including Git, Docker images, virtual environments, etc.
- Complete tasks with minimal direction.
- Work as part of an Agile software development team.
- Other duties as assigned.
Requirements
The following minimum qualifications are required for the position:
- A bachelor’s degree in computer science, engineering, mathematics, or physical sciences
- Academic or Professional experience with Python 3.6 or later
- Experience with libraries such as Numpy, Scipy, Pandas, Plotly
- Experience with object relational databases (PostgreSQL, MySQL, etc) or experience with Dash and/or Flask web applications
- A general knowledge of data structures and algorithms
- A working knowledge of object-oriented design patterns
- Academic or Professional experience using Linux operating systems, including bash scripting and related concepts
- The ability to obtain and maintain a DoD security clearance
- Good verbal and written communication skills
Candidates who have any of the following skills will be preferred:
- Familiarity with Python coding standards (PEP8, etc.)
- Experience with packaging and deploying Python modules & packages using pipenv or uv
- Familiarity with sockets and/or google protobuf
- Exception and error handling for recovery and graceful degradation
- Application containerization and orchestration with Docker, docker-compose, podman, Kubernetes, etc.
- Process automation and CI/CD in Jenkins, gitlab-ci or similar
- An active DoD security clearance
